Trails Skied: Fortune Pkwy, #40, #1 (blue), Glide Wax: LF8, Grip Wax:

Freshly groomed, sugar snow made for great skate skiing from P10 up the Fortune Parkway, then on ridge road to #40.

#40 was also freshly groomed all the way to the Meech lake parking lot. It was fun to get the change of scenery. However, you have to pay attention for small branches, wood chips, sawdust where work has been done to clear fallen trees and branches. Pay particular attention to the occasional sharp-ended piece of wood embedded in the trail.

Gatineau Park is ski paradise! The network of ski trails offer machine groomed skate skiing and classic skiing as well as little groomed backcountry trails. Multiple access points allow skiers to access a variety of terrain and scenery. The NCC offers season or daily pay rates.
